Surviving the Track: The Ultimate Guide to the Assetto Corsa T-Rex Mod
T-Rex Mod is one of the most famously absurd, entertaining, and chaotic community creations in the history of racing simulations . Known formally within the community for turning a serious, laser-scanned racing simulator into a prehistoric survival nightmare, this mod swaps out traditional hypercars for a fully drivable, 700-horsepower Tyrannosaurus Rex. While Assetto Corsa is built on ultra-realistic physics engine principles, the T-Rex mod deliberately breaks all the rules of physics.
